Transaction 506561c85e3c59f303f1a628d78cc3b9336ae3bc96dba60f5146dc450dfcff71
1 Input
1 Output
-
506561c85e3c59f303f1a628d78cc3b9336ae3bc96dba60f5146dc450dfcff71:0
- value
- 14997120
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f3c0937639af9db98df0fe811c162713a5ee5db
- address
- bc1qru7qjdmrntuahxxlpl5prstzwya9aewm55gk07